Cherry Rice Krispie Treats: A Sweet, Simple Recipe!

  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 16 squares 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Cherry Rice Krispie Treats are a delightful sweet snack made with Rice Krispies, marshmallows, and dried cherries, per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ups Rice Krispies
  • 10 oz mini marshmallows
  • 4 tbsp unsalted butter
  • 1 cup dried cherries (or fresh, pitted)
  • 1 tsp cherry extract
  • Red food coloring (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prepare your workspace by gathering all ingredients and tools.
  2. In a large saucepan over low heat, melt the butter until bubbly. Add mini marshmallows and stir continuously until melted and smooth.
  3. Remove from heat and blend in dried cherries and cherry extract (and food coloring if using).
  4. Gently fold in Rice Krispies until well combined.
  5.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ish and press down firmly.
  6. Allow to cool completely before slicing into squares.

Notes

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to one week.
  • You can substitute dried cherries with other fruits like cranberries or raisins.
